Built for the Fox Valley’s active community
Our Appleton clinic sits on the east side of the city near the Darboy area, off to the side of the busy Highway 441 corridor, which keeps us convenient for patients across the Fox Cities. We regularly treat people from Appleton, Neenah, Menasha, Kaukauna, Kimberly, Little Chute, and Grand Chute.
The Fox Valley is an active place, and that shapes what we see. There is a deep running and racing community along the Fox River trails, a strong youth and high school sports scene, plenty of lifting and rec-league athletes, and a lot of manufacturing and trades work that is hard on backs, shoulders, and elbows. The long Wisconsin winters add their own load, from shoveling strains to slips on the ice to people ramping back up too fast in spring.
That mix is exactly what a sports chiropractic and rehab clinic is built for: sports injuries and overuse, work-related back and shoulder pain, and stubborn tendon problems that rest never finished off.

Meet the doctors at our Appleton clinic
Licensed Doctors of Chiropractic who treat you personally, every visit.

Sam founded Rehab Lab because he is meticulous about the “why.” A board-certified sports physician (DACBSP), he blends precise adjustments, soft-tissue work, and dry needling with a clear, progressive plan, guided by his belief that movement is medicine.

Nate leads our Appleton clinic, bringing more than a decade of hands-on experience from Denver to the Fox Valley. A movement-first clinician, he combines functional assessment (SFMA), dry needling, and IASTM to find the root cause and get you moving again, then keep you there.

A native of Northeast Wisconsin and former multi-sport athlete, Dr. Markowski earned his Doctor of Chiropractic from Palmer College and practiced for four years before partnering with Dr. Sam. He blends extremity work, dry needling, and movement assessment to find the root cause.

A Green Bay native and Packers fan, Dr. Peda paired a Kinesiology background with chiropractic to treat athletes and active adults. He earned his Doctorate at Palmer College and practiced in northeastern Wisconsin for over four years before joining Rehab Lab.

Do I need a referral to come in?
No. You can book directly with our Appleton clinic. If you are recovering from a car accident or a doctor-referred injury, we are happy to coordinate with your care team.
